From f53913389fa435d26307075bf5dab3675b1f17c4 Mon Sep 17 00:00:00 2001 From: "bozo.kopic" Date: Mon, 8 Apr 2019 22:47:10 +0200 Subject: dependencies update & minor fixes --- node_modules.patch | 41 +++++++++++++++++++++++++++++++++++++++++ 1 file changed, 41 insertions(+) create mode 100644 node_modules.patch (limited to 'node_modules.patch') diff --git a/node_modules.patch b/node_modules.patch new file mode 100644 index 0000000..5391749 --- /dev/null +++ b/node_modules.patch @@ -0,0 +1,41 @@ +--- node_modules/snabbdom/es/modules/props.js ++++ node_modules/snabbdom/es/modules/props.js +@@ -8,7 +8,11 @@ + props = props || {}; + for (key in oldProps) { + if (!props[key]) { +- delete elm[key]; ++ if (key === 'style') { ++ elm[key] = ''; ++ } else { ++ delete elm[key]; ++ } + } + } + for (key in props) { + + +--- node_modules/snabbdom/es/modules/attributes.js ++++ node_modules/snabbdom/es/modules/attributes.js +@@ -22,20 +22,7 @@ + elm.removeAttribute(key); + } + else { +- if (key.charCodeAt(0) !== xChar) { +- elm.setAttribute(key, cur); +- } +- else if (key.charCodeAt(3) === colonChar) { +- // Assume xml namespace +- elm.setAttributeNS(xmlNS, key, cur); +- } +- else if (key.charCodeAt(5) === colonChar) { +- // Assume xlink namespace +- elm.setAttributeNS(xlinkNS, key, cur); +- } +- else { +- elm.setAttribute(key, cur); +- } ++ elm.setAttribute(key, cur); + } + } + } -- cgit v1.2.3-70-g09d2